From 263cdaab1f3e02a5e5d9c86afd7aefaaa9734a38 Mon Sep 17 00:00:00 2001 From: lhb <495598773@qq.com> Date: Wed, 16 Apr 2025 14:14:21 +0800 Subject: [PATCH] =?UTF-8?q?fix:=E7=94=A8=E6=88=B7=E5=88=86=E9=85=8D?= =?UTF-8?q?=E8=A7=92=E8=89=B2=E7=94=B1=E5=A4=9A=E8=A7=92=E8=89=B2=E4=BF=AE?= =?UTF-8?q?=E6=94=B9=E4=B8=BA=E5=8D=95=E8=A7=92=E8=89=B2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../evotech/hd/common/core/entity/cloud/BatteryStation.java | 6 ++++++ .../hd/resource/service/impl/AuthUserServiceImpl.java | 3 +++ 2 files changed, 9 insertions(+) diff --git a/base-commons/common-core/src/main/java/com/evotech/hd/common/core/entity/cloud/BatteryStation.java b/base-commons/common-core/src/main/java/com/evotech/hd/common/core/entity/cloud/BatteryStation.java index edcfbc7..91a833e 100644 --- a/base-commons/common-core/src/main/java/com/evotech/hd/common/core/entity/cloud/BatteryStation.java +++ b/base-commons/common-core/src/main/java/com/evotech/hd/common/core/entity/cloud/BatteryStation.java @@ -145,5 +145,11 @@ public class BatteryStation implements Serializable { @Schema(description = "换电费用标准", hidden = true) @TableField(exist = false) private List feeStandardList; + + @Schema(description = "营业起时间") + private String runStartTime; + + @Schema(description = "营业止时间") + private String runEndTime; } diff --git a/resource-server/src/main/java/com/evotech/hd/resource/service/impl/AuthUserServiceImpl.java b/resource-server/src/main/java/com/evotech/hd/resource/service/impl/AuthUserServiceImpl.java index 027697f..6c28c8c 100644 --- a/resource-server/src/main/java/com/evotech/hd/resource/service/impl/AuthUserServiceImpl.java +++ b/resource-server/src/main/java/com/evotech/hd/resource/service/impl/AuthUserServiceImpl.java @@ -108,6 +108,9 @@ public class AuthUserServiceImpl implements AuthUserService { @Override public Result addUserRole(AuthUserRole aur) { + authUserRoleDao.delete(new QueryWrapper() + .eq("uid", aur.getUid()));//先删除该用户的所有角色 + boolean exists = authUserRoleDao.exists(new QueryWrapper() .eq("uid", aur.getUid()).eq("rcode", aur.getRcode())); if (exists) {